Jeff Gordinier takes the A train uptown to the laid back Indian Road Cafe, where he falls for simple, well executed food like a shrimp and bacon sandwich with chipotle mayo and skirt steak accompanied by potatoes and goat cheese aioli. It's a "restaurant that seems to exist so far from the assembly line of trends that you believe you're a few thousand miles from New York. I mean that as a compliment. We could all use a road trip."
